What is the difference between Applications Engineer vs Mechanical Engineer?
| Aspect | Applications Engineer | Mechanical Engineer |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's in engineering or related field, often with industry-specific certifications | Bachelor's or higher in mechanical engineering, often with licensure or professional engineer (PE) license |
| Work Environment | Customer-facing, technical support, product demonstrations, and sales collaboration | Design, analysis, manufacturing, and testing in labs or manufacturing plants |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Tech companies, manufacturing, industrial equipment, and engineering services | Automotive, aerospace, manufacturing, and energy sectors |
Applications Engineers focus on technical support, product demonstrations, and customer interaction, often requiring strong communication skills. Mechanical Engineers primarily work on designing, analyzing, and testing mechanical systems. While both roles require engineering degrees, their work environments and daily tasks differ significantly, catering to different aspects of engineering and customer engagement.

The Field Applications Engineer is responsible for partnering with Sales and providing Analog related technical expertise throughout the sales cycle. The FAE proactively identifies current products and/or creative solutions to solve existing customer projects and create new functionality/opportunities. In this role, the FAE uses in-depth product knowledge to provide technical expertise to gain credibility and develop relationships with customers.
Primary responsibilities include:
Strategic Customer Engagement
- Lead technical relationships with major mobile OEMs and ODMs
- Influence customer platform architecture and drive long-term design-win strategies
- Serve as the trusted technical advisor for battery management and power system solutions
- Identify future customer requirements and translate them into product roadmap recommendations
Technical Leadership
- Provide expert-level support for Battery Charger, Fuel Gauge, Battery Protection, and PMIC products.
- Lead complex system-level debugging involving hardware, firmware, and battery interactions.
- Support power architecture optimization for smartphones, tablets, wearables, and other portable devices.
- Perform root cause analysis for critical field issues.
Cross-functional Collaboration
- Work closely with Application Engineering, Systems Engineering and Marketing, Quality teams.
- Drive issue resolution across global organizations under aggressive customer schedules.
- Mentor junior FAEs and provide technical leadership within the regional applications team.
Business Impact
- Support annual revenue growth through successful design-in and design-win activities.
- Manage multiple strategic customer projects simultaneously.
- Deliver executive-level technical presentations to customer engineering and management teams.

Job requirements:
- Bachelor's or Master's degree in Electrical Engineering or a related field.
- 5+ years of experience in Semiconductor FAE, Applications Engineering, or Hardware System Design.
- Experience supporting top-tier global mobile OEMs.
- Deep understanding of smartphone power tree architecture.
- Experience supporting smartphone or portable electronics customers.
- Strong expertise in:
- Lithium-ion battery systems and smartphone battery management architectures (BMS)
- Fuel Gauge technologies and algorithms, including SOC/SOH estimation, battery profiling, and model-based gauging methods
- Battery characterization, profiling, calibration, and system validation for portable applications
- Battery charging, protection, safety, and authentication architectures
- PMIC and analog power management solutions for smartphones, tablets, and wearables
- Understanding for MCU-based embedded systems, battery-related system debugging
- Field application support and root-cause analysis for Fuel Gauge and battery system issues.
- Strong understanding of smartphone battery industry trends, customer requirements, and next-generation battery technologies
- Proven track record of driving strategic design wins.
- Strong verbal and written communication skills in English.
Minimum requ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in EE/Comp Eng, or comparable
- Minimum XX years of experience in Analog disciplines applicable to our customer's end equipment spaces such as sensors, signal conditioning, data acquisition, power design, clocking and timing, or data communications
- Experience with design, analysis, and debug of related circuits or sub-systems
- Ability to run simulations, and create/ review schematics and board layout
- Ability to help customers debug board level issues
